A sprocket is a rotating mechanical wheel with teeth that engage with roller or conveyor chains to facilitate their movement in various applications and equipment. As the sprocket rotates around a central shaft, the specially designed teeth engage the gaps in the chain to pull it with a secure grip, regardless of whether it is in dirty or oily environments. Although they may resemble gears, sprockets are designed solely to work with drive chains, not other sprockets or gears.We stock a full line of ANSI single-strand 304-grade stainless steel sprockets, both as A-Plate style and B-Hub style. Which is Better-Aluminum or Steel for Sprockets?
Steel and aluminum are the two most commonly used materials for sprockets. Most manufacturers use steel sprockets; however, aluminum offers characteristics that some riders will find more appealing.Steel sprockets are more affordable than aluminum and tend to have a longer lifespan. Because rear sprockets are smaller and more durable sprockets are essential, most rear sprockets are made of steel.For riders who are looking for sprockets that can help increase their speed, aluminum is usually the go-to choice. Aluminum sprockets are much lighter than steel, making them an excellent choice for the motorcyclist who wants to reduce bike weight. Even though aluminum sprockets are anodized, they tend to degrade much faster than sprockets that are made out of steel.
